3.5 Stacking Scenario Examples

Use Ethernet cables when stacking the switches. See the following figures for example stacking scenarios using the
stacking module. The switches must form a closed ring in all scenarios.

Table 3-2 ES-3024 Switches: LED Descriptions
STATUS
Blinking
The system is rebooting and performing self-diagnostic tests.
ON
The system is on and functioning properly.
OFF
The power is off or the system is not ready/malfunctioning.
ON
There is a hardware failure.
OFF
The system is functioning normally.
Blinking
The system is transmitting/receiving to/from a 10 Mbps Ethernet network.
ON
The link to a 10 Mbps Ethernet network is up.
OFF
The link to a 10 Mbps Ethernet network is down.
Blinking
The system is transmitting/receiving to/from a 100 Mbps Ethernet network.
ON
The link to a 100 Mbps Ethernet network is up.
OFF
The link to a 100 Mbps Ethernet network is down.
Blinking
The Ethernet port is negotiating in half-duplex mode and collisions are
occurring; the more collisions that occur the faster the LED blinks.
ON
The Ethernet port is negotiating in full-duplex mode.
OFF
The Ethernet port is negotiating in half-duplex mode and no collisions are
occurring.
